Point of
Operation Guarding
The machine must not be operated without point of
operation guarding. It is the responsibility of
the user to insure the machine is operated safely
and has appropriate guards for the type of work
being performed. The manufacturer can not satisfy
the guarding requirements for the many and varied
applications these machines can perform. The
manufacturer will assist the purchaser with his
selection of guarding and will offer factory
installation of the guarding selected by the
purchaser.

Hydraulic
System
The entire hydraulic system is to JIC standards
and makes maximum use
of flared fittings, installed with the ultimate
in simplicity and accessibility to servicing the
circuit components. The hydraulic oil tank is
designed for operation on 100% duty cycle, with
sufficient oil capacity to dissipate any
significant temperature rise above normal
operating levels. All valves are tagged with
identification and pressure settings to simplify
servicing.

Machine
Features
Control
Panel
The control panel features a lockable mode
selector to provide "Off", "Inching"
and "Single Cycle" functions. In the
Off position the machine is completely inactive.
The Inching mode allows the operator to gradually
move the top
beam down to check the work prior to taking the
cut or to facilitate checking knife clearance
when this may become necessary. This function can
also be used to maintain hold down pressure after
taking a cut to allow the operator
to support the material on the table and prevent
it from falling after the hold down's have
released.
Knife
Clearance Adjustment
A two-point
knife clearance adjustment is provided as
standard equipment. However, because of the basic
design and structural rigidity of these shears,
virtually any thickness of stock can be cut - to
the maximum capacity - without adjusting knife
clearance.
Being mounted
on eccentric pins or cams, the bearings serve as
a simple knife clearance adjustment. These two
bearings are the only two critical wearing points
in the entire machine design. On larger capacity
shears
where frequent changes in knife clearance are
necessary, clearances can
be altered swiftly and accurately to graduations
shown on a knife clearance indicator.
Stroke
Length Adjustment
By means of a simple thumb screw the stroke
length may be adjusted to reduce cycle time and
increase productivity on shorter work by as much
as an additional 80%.

Front
Operated Manual Back Gauge System
This
illustration shows the precision gear drives
which are fully sealed and
pre-lubricated. The drive train runs from a 1 HP
motor coupled to the manual fine adjustment hand-wheel
and this shaft in turn drives the self locking
reduction gearbox. On both output shafts of this
gearbox are two indexing couplings which provide
a simple and convenient means of adjustment to
compensate for any back gauge errors. From these
couplings the drive train runs through two
precision gearboxes which rotate the rolled acme
shafts.
